Luca della Valle was born in Santa Maria C. V. a little town south of Naples in Italy. Luca trained Method Acting at "Teatri Possibili Speech and Drama Academy" in Milan, IT (2000/2002). Luca moved to London in 2005 where he studied English and Acting for Film & TV at The Actors Center (2009/2011), Meisner Technique with Dannie-Lu Carr at City Lit, and privately coached by Michael Duval from The Actor Studio New York. Luca played Luca the Racetrack Head Security in The Man from U.N.C.L.E. (2015) starring Henry Cavill Alicia Vikander Armie Hammer Elizabeth Debicki and Hugh Grant directed by Guy Ritchie. Born 1989 from an Italian father and an American mother, he exploded on the web as soon as he was 18, posting phone pranks on his YouTube channel. In 2009 he landed on Le Iene, which he was tied to at length initially as a field reporter, and later as a show host. In 2015 he debuted as a judge for Italia's Got Talent, turning out to be so right for and at ease in the role that he got called back for all six of the next seasons. In 2021 he starred in the first and enthralling season of LOL - chi ride è fuori (Last One Laughing) which airs exclusively on Amazon Prime Video. He already has seven movies on his resume, including Sono Tornato (I'm Back), by Luca Miniero, Tonno Spiaggiato, written by Matano himself together with Matteo Martinez, and the upcoming Una notte da dottore, with Diego Abatantuono. Giulio Donadio was born on 5 July 1889 in Santa Maria Capua Vetere, Campania, Italy. He was an actor and director, known for La bella giardiniera (1919), I cercatori d'oro (1920) and Il microfono del selenio (1920).
